Weixuan Li is a scholar working on Statistics, Probability and Uncertainty, Ocean Engineering and Artificial Intelligence. According to data from OpenAlex, Weixuan Li has authored 26 papers receiving a total of 404 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Statistics, Probability and Uncertainty, 5 papers in Ocean Engineering and 5 papers in Artificial Intelligence. Recurrent topics in Weixuan Li's work include Probabilistic and Robust Engineering Design (9 papers), Quantum and electron transport phenomena (3 papers) and Reservoir Engineering and Simulation Methods (3 papers). Weixuan Li is often cited by papers focused on Probabilistic and Robust Engineering Design (9 papers), Quantum and electron transport phenomena (3 papers) and Reservoir Engineering and Simulation Methods (3 papers). Weixuan Li collaborates with scholars based in China and United States. Weixuan Li's co-authors include Guang Lin, Laosheng Wu, Lingzao Zeng, Jiangjiang Zhang, Dongxiao Zhang, Zhiming Lü, Jun Man, Chuanli Zhao, Jihao Wang and Yalin Lu and has published in prestigious journals such as SHILAP Revista de lepidopterología, Water Resources Research and Journal of Computational Physics.
